From Simple Commands to Conversational AI

Initially, personal assistants like Siri and Alexa relied on straightforward voice commands. Users could request actions such as setting reminders or playing music. This basic functionality provided convenience but lacked depth.

As technology evolved, conversational AI emerged. Systems began to understand context and engage in more natural dialogues. This innovation allowed assistants to answer complex queries and carry on extended conversations. Large language models significantly contributed to this shift, enabling these systems to generate human-like responses.

The seamless integration of these capabilities transformed user interactions. They became more intuitive, allowing for a richer user experience. As a result, assistants now serve not only functional roles but also facilitate engaging conversations.

Machine Learning and Self-Teaching Algorithms

Machine learning has played a crucial role in the evolution of AI assistants. Through continuous data analysis, these systems improve their performance over time. This enables personal assistants to understand user preferences and provide tailored responses.

Self-teaching algorithms further enhance capabilities. These algorithms allow assistants to learn from interactions without human intervention. As they gather more data, their proficiency grows, improving accuracy in understanding context and nuances.

Generative AI complements machine learning by enabling assistants to create original content. This includes generating responses or even drafting emails based on user instructions. Consequently, AI-powered personal assistants have become increasingly versatile. They support a wide range of tasks, reshaping the landscape of digital assistance.

Smart Home Devices and Integration

Integrating AI assistants with smart home devices transforms how users interact with their living spaces. These systems provide seamless control over various home functions.

  • Device Compatibility: Many AI assistants support devices like smart thermostats, lights, security cameras, and appliances. Users can control these devices via voice commands or apps.
  • Energy Management: AI can learn user habits and adjust settings to improve energy efficiency. For example, smart thermostats can optimise heating and cooling based on occupancy patterns.

This integration not only enhances convenience but also improves energy efficiency and home security.

Data Security and User Trust

Data security is paramount in fostering user trust. AI assistants handle sensitive information during live conversations and when storing notes. Safeguarding this data with robust encryption and adhering to privacy regulations is essential.

Users need assurance that their information is secure and not misused. Implementing clear privacy policies helps build confidence in the technology. Additionally, giving users control over their data, such as options to delete or export information, further strengthens trust.

Transparent communication about how data is used can alleviate concerns and increase user satisfaction. Ultimately, a secure environment encourages greater usage and reliance on AI-powered assistants.
